Company overview

The American Farm Bureau Federation (AFBF) is a national organization representing the interests of American farmers and ranchers. It advocates for agricultural policies, provides educational resources, and offers various services to its members. Founded in 1919, the AFBF has a long history of influencing agricultural legislation and promoting rural prosperity. The organization generates revenue through membership dues, sponsorships, and events.
